Advanced Marijuana Decannabisation Equipment
The increasing demand for refined cannabis goods has spurred significant innovation in post-harvest handling. Traditional destemming, often a labor-intensive and time-consuming procedure, is proving insufficient for larger-scale growing facilities. Consequently, there's a rising adoption of automated cannabis destemming machines designed to rapidly and precisely separate stems from bud. These sophisticated solutions typically incorporate transport belts, cutting mechanisms, and often, quality control software to minimize loss and maximize output. The ability to expeditiously process large volumes of plant biomass contributes to enhanced operational throughput and reduced labor costs.

Automated Cannabis Trimming for Massive Crops
As the plant cultivation moves toward larger scale operations, the labor-intensive process of manicuring buds becomes a significant bottleneck. Manual trimming is slow, costly, and prone to inconsistencies in quality, leading to reduced yields and increased labor expenses. Machine trimming technology offers a viable solution, especially for substantial harvests. These systems, ranging from simple models to advanced robotic arms, can significantly reduce labor read more hours while maintaining a high degree of flower consistency. The upfront cost can be offset by higher throughput and the ability to handle larger volumes, ultimately boosting the grower's bottom line. Some cultivators are also finding that automated trimming can alleviate staffing challenges which are increasingly common in the sector.
